Abstract

A cylinder tube of a toy gun is disclosed. A cylinder head is mounted on the cylinder tube of the toy gun. A tube passage is formed to penetrate through the cylinder head. Several air induction passages are formed circularly around the tube passage. A control device is applied to the air induction passages for opening or closing the air induction passages according to the forward or backward movement of the piston. As a result, much more air can be sucked into the air storage chamber immediately after the backward movement of the piston. Accordingly, the air capacity of the cylinder tube can be increased so as to produce larger air pressure for pushing the bullet to the outside of the toy gun, thereby improving the shooting performance of the toy gun and providing the simulated recoil effect, which simulates the real shooting.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A cylinder tube of a toy gun comprising:
 a cylinder tube for holding a piston, said cylinder tube having a cylinder head on a front end thereof, said cylinder being penetrated through by a tube passage, said cylinder head having at least an air induction passage around said tube passage circularly; and   a control device for correspondingly opening or closing said air induction passage according to the movement of said piston, said control device being a movable plate.   
   
   
       2 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 1 , wherein said movable plate has an opening on the center thereof corresponding to said tube passage. 
   
   
       3 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 1 , wherein said movable plate is a thin rubber plate. 
   
   
       4 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 1 , wherein said movable plate is a thin steel plate. 
   
   
       5 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 1 , wherein said movable plate is a thin leaf spring. 
   
   
       6 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 1 , wherein an outer cover is connected to one end of said cylinder head, the center of said outer cover is communicated with one end of said tube passage for forming an opening, said outer cover has a plurality of through holes, which are staggered with said air induction passage, and a plurality of air inlets formed between notches on the bottom of said outer cover and said cylinder head for communicating said air induction passage with said air storage chamber. 
   
   
       7 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 1 , wherein an outer cover is connected to one end of said cylinder head, and said movable plate is affixed to said outer cover by a light spring. 
   
   
       8 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 1 , wherein one end of said movable plate is affixed to the inside of said cylinder head by a nail. 
   
   
       9 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 1 , wherein said movable plate is coupled with said tube passage via a hollow rod. 
   
   
       10 . A cylinder tube of a toy gun comprising:
 a cylinder tube for holding a piston, said cylinder tube having a cylinder head on a front end thereof, said cylinder being penetrated through by a tube passage, said cylinder head having at least an air induction passage around said tube passage circularly; and   a control device for correspondingly opening or closing said air induction passage according to the movement of said piston, said control device being a movable valve.   
   
   
       11 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 10 , wherein at least an air inlet is formed on said movable plat and staggered with said air induction passage. 
   
   
       12 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 10 , wherein two blocks are formed on both ends of said movable valve, respectively, for closing said air induction passage and for limiting the connection of said movable valve. 
   
   
       13 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 10 , wherein said movable valve is coupled with said tube passage via a hollow valve rod. 
   
   
       14 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 10 , wherein two blocks are formed on both ends of said movable valve, respectively, said movable valve is pivotally coupled with said tube passage via a hollow valve rod, and one of said blocks is to shift said movable valve by connection with a pull rod. 
   
   
       15 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 10 , wherein a plurality of pivotal connection holes are formed circularly on said cylinder head for pivotal connection with a plurality of valve rods of said movable valve. 
   
   
       16 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 10 , wherein a plurality of pivotal connection holes are formed circularly on said cylinder head for pivotal connection with a plurality of valve rods of said movable valve, said movable valve has an opening corresponding to said tube passage, and a spring is sleeved onto each of said valve rods. 
   
   
       17 . A cylinder tube of a toy gun comprising:
 a cylinder tube for holding a piston, said cylinder tube having a cylinder head on a front end thereof, said cylinder being penetrated through by a tube passage, said cylinder head having at least an air induction passage around said tube passage circularly; and   a control device for correspondingly opening or closing said air induction passage according to the movement of said piston, said control device being a steel ball valve.   
   
   
       18 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 17 , wherein said air induction passage of said cylinder tube is a cone-shaped passage, and at least a blocking pillar is located on a larger opening of said air induction passage for forming at least two air inlets. 
   
   
       19 . The cylinder tube of the toy gun of  claim 17 , wherein said air induction passage of said cylinder tube is a cone-shaped passage, at least a blocking pillar is located on a larger opening of said air induction passage for forming at least two air inlets, and the diameter of said steel ball valve is larger than the calibers of said air inlets and a smaller opening of said air induction passage.
